This has been asked and answered many times on this thread recently.

Separate reservation will have its own baggage allowance. Class/Status/CreditCard may help but that should be clear from AI website.

You will be going through customs and checking in at BOM.

This is not India specific problem,

Think about flying BA from LHR to LAX in First and then buying a separate ticket on frontier or spirit or even united. They will not give a damn that you flew from London or flew on FIrst class on BA.

The best shot would be to have Singapore add separately purchased segment to your original PNR. (SIA may be able to sell you that segment on AI)
